How they compare

Niger currently reports 10.72 kilowatt-hours per person against 0 kilowatt-hours per person in New Caledonia, a difference of 10.72 kilowatt-hours per person.

Across all 45 years both countries report, Niger has been ahead every year.

New Caledonia ranks 128th and Niger ranks 125th of 215 countries.

Niger has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
